If you’re planning a trip to Indonesia in the near future, you may want to exchange some of your money into rupiah, the country’s official currency. The international symbol for the currency is IDR.
If you’re entering Indonesia with more than 100 million IDR (roughly $6,500 USD), you’ll have to declare the currency.

Calculating a conversion from dollars to rupiah is fairly simple. You can either use a currency calculator or do it by hand.
Using a currency conversion calculator is often the easiest way to get an estimate when you’re converting currency. Since exchange rates fluctuate on a daily basis, using a calculator can ensure your math is correct.
Keep in mind that exchanging currency often comes with added fees that a conversion calculator won’t be able to predict. For instance, credit card companies and ATM networks usually charge a 1% conversion fee on all foreign transactions. Individual merchants may also charge supplemental fees if you ask them to convert the price of an item to your home currency at checkout.
The other option is to do the calculation manually using a simple mathematical formula. However, in order to do this, you need to know the current exchange rate. At the time of writing, $1 USD is worth Rp 15,562 IDR.
Once you know that information, multiply the amount you have in USD by the current exchange rate. The resulting number will show you the amount of rupiah that you have to spend on your trip.
Let’s say you have $1,200 USD and would like to figure out how much rupiah you have for a trip to Indonesia. Using the current exchange rate, the formula for your conversion would look like this:
$1,200 USD x 15,562 = Rp 18,674,400 IDR
